### Job summary

he Southampton Mental Health Liaison Teamis a PLAN accredited service andis developed to meet the HIOW mental health transformation priorities.Our serviceoperatesat the vital interface between physical and mental health, delivering assessment,supportand intervention to patients in acute hospital settings includingtheEmergency Department and inpatient wards.

We are pleased tooffer multiple administrative vacancieswithinthe team. These rolesprovidean exciting opportunity to join a well-established, supportive, and forward-thinking team at a time of continued service development aligned to the national Core 24 model.

We are recruiting multiple Band 3 administrative roles within our busy and supportive Mental Health Liaison Team, working across the Southampton General Hospital site. While both contribute to the same team, they differ in duties and working patterns:

Team Secretary (Shift-Based Role)

- Provides administrative support to the wider multidisciplinary team
- 7-day rota, including weekends and bank holidays
- Shiftsinclude;early, day, and late (between 07:00--21:00).

Medical Secretary (Weekday Role)

- Provides dedicated secretarial support to consultants and senior clinicians.
- Monday to Friday, 09:00--17:00.
- Focus on clinical correspondence, diary management, and coordination.

### Main duties of the job

- To ensure quality secretarial / administration service is provided to the team and/or senior clinical colleagues
- To take and process telephone enquiries and referrals from University Hospital Southampton NHS Foundation Trust (UHSFT) staff teams, General Practitioners, patients/clients, relatives, other hospitals and agencies.
- To support with the booking of appointments and diary co-ordination
- To be responsible for coordination of meetings including taking minutes in MDTs, Best Interest Meetings/Professional Meetings.

### About us

Hampshire and Isle of Wight Healthcare NHS Foundation Trust provides joined-up mental and physical healthcare for around two million people across our communities. With over 13,000 staff working in the community and local hospitals, we deliver care at every stage of life, helping people live their best and healthiest lives.

Our mental health services include community-based support and early intervention in psychosis (EIP) for both adults and young people, alongside a network of specialist inpatient wards covering forensic, learning disability, eating disorder and older person's care.

We deliver extensive physical health services too, from urgent community response teams helping frail and older patients remain safely at home, to hospitals at home teams providing acute-level care in familiar surroundings. Our neurological services offer rehabilitation and treatment for conditions including Multiple Sclerosis, Parkinson's Disease, Motor Neurone Disease, Head Injury, Cerebral Palsy and Stroke. Across Hampshire, our community hospitals provide inpatient rehabilitation as a step down from acute care, and our dedicated teams also staff Treetops Sexual Assault Referral Centre in Portsmouth, offering expert, compassionate support.

Everything we do is underpinned by our CARE values of compassion, accountability, respect and excellence
